6.3.5.3 Safety setpoint telegram (PNU 60024)
Use this parameter to acyclically read out the entire current safety-related process output data. As the
process output data of the standard telegrams 36 (BP/XP) and 37 (BP/XP) do not differ, signal
number 98 (Encoder F control word 1, S_STW1_ENC) and PNU 62000 (F preset value, S_PRESET32)
are read back.
PNU
60024
Meaning
Safety setpoint value telegram
Data type
OctetString[n]
Access
read
Value range
S_STW1_ENC: Unsigned16 + S_PRESET32: Integer32
6.3.5.4 Safety setpoint telegram (PNU 60025)
Use this parameter to acyclically read out the entire current safety-related process input data.
Depending on the configured standard telegram 36 (BP/XP) / 37 (BP/XP), signal numbers 96 (F actual
position value, S_XIST32), 97 (F actual speed value, S_NIST16) and 99 (Encoder F status word 1,
S_ZSW1_ENC) are read back.
PNU
60025
Meaning
Safety actual value telegram
Data type
OctetString[n]
Access
read
Value range
S_ZSW1_ENC: Unsigned16 + S_NIST16: Integer16 + S_XIST32: Integer32
6.3.5.5 Safety preset value S_PRESET32 (PNU 62000)
This parameter contains the safety-related preset value transmitted via the cyclic output data
S_PRESET32, see Chapter 6.3.1.7 on Page 75.
PNU
62000
Meaning
Safety preset value 32 bit
Data type
Integer32
Access
read
